ادغام i-mobile با واسطه

این راهنما به شما نشان می دهد که چگونه از Google Mobile Ads SDK برای بارگیری و نمایش تبلیغات از i-mobile با استفاده از میانجیگری AdMob ،پوشش ادغام آبشار نحوه افزودن i-mobile به پیکربندی میانجی واحد تبلیغاتی و نحوه ادغام i-mobile SDK و آداپتور در یک Android برنامه

رابط داشبورد i-mobile از متن ژاپنی برای برچسب‌ها، دکمه‌ها و توضیحات خود استفاده می‌کند. اسکرین شات های این راهنما ترجمه نشده اند. با این حال، در توضیحات و دستورالعمل‌های این راهنما، برچسب‌ها و دکمه‌ها با معادل‌های انگلیسی خود در پرانتز ترجمه شده‌اند.

ادغام ها و قالب های تبلیغاتی پشتیبانی شده

آداپتور میانجی برای i-mobile دارای قابلیت های زیر است:

یکپارچه سازی
مناقصه
آبشار
فرمت ها
بنر
بینابینی
پاداش داده شد
بومی

الزامات

  • Android API سطح 21 یا بالاتر
  • جدیدترین SDK تبلیغات موبایل گوگل

  • راهنمای شروع میانجیگری را کامل کنید

مرحله 1: تنظیمات را در i-mobile UI تنظیم کنید

ثبت نام کنید یا به حساب آی موبایل خود وارد شوید .

با کلیک کردن روی تب (مدیریت سایت/برنامه) و دکمه پلت فرم برنامه خود، برنامه خود را به داشبورد i-mobile اضافه کنید.

فرم را پر کنید و روی دکمه新規登録 (ثبت نام) کلیک کنید.

برای ایجاد یک مکان تبلیغاتی جدید، برنامه خود را در زیر تبサイト/アプリ管理 (مدیریت سایت/برنامه) انتخاب کنید.

به تب広告スポット管理 (مدیریت مکان تبلیغات) بروید و روی دکمه新規広告スポット (نقطه تبلیغاتی جدید) کلیک کنید.

create_ad_spot

سپس، فرم را با ارائه告スポットサイズ (اندازه آگهی) و سایر جزئیات، پر کنید. سپس، روی دکمه新規登録 (ثبت نام) کلیک کنید.

new_ad_spot_form

محل آگهی جدید شما آماده است. برای مشاهده جزئیات ادغام آن، روی دکمهアプリ設定取得 (دریافت تنظیمات برنامه) کلیک کنید.

ad_spot_list

به شناسه パブリッシャーشناسه (شناسه ناشر) ، شناسه (شناسه رسانه) و شناسه (شناسه نقطه ای) توجه داشته باشید. بعداً هنگام پیکربندی i-mobile برای میانجیگری در رابط کاربری AdMob به این پارامترها نیاز خواهید داشت.

مرحله 2: تقاضای i-mobile را در آن تنظیم کنید AdMob UI

تنظیمات میانجی را برای واحد تبلیغات خود پیکربندی کنید

باید i-mobile را به پیکربندی میانجی واحد تبلیغاتی خود اضافه کنید.

ابتدا وارد حساب AdMob خود شوید. سپس به تب Mediation بروید. اگر گروه میانجی موجودی دارید که می‌خواهید آن را تغییر دهید، روی نام آن گروه میانجی کلیک کنید تا آن را ویرایش کنید و به افزودن i-mobile به عنوان منبع آگهی بروید.

برای ایجاد یک گروه میانجی جدید، Create Mediation Group را انتخاب کنید.

قالب و پلتفرم تبلیغ خود را وارد کنید، سپس روی Continue کلیک کنید.

به گروه میانجی خود یک نام بدهید و مکان‌هایی را برای هدف انتخاب کنید. سپس، وضعیت گروه میانجی را روی Enabled تنظیم کنید و سپس روی Add Units Ad Units کلیک کنید.

این گروه میانجی را با یک یا چند واحد تبلیغات AdMob موجود خود مرتبط کنید. سپس روی Done کلیک کنید.

اکنون باید کارت واحدهای تبلیغاتی را با واحدهای تبلیغاتی که انتخاب کرده‌اید مشاهده کنید:

i-mobile را به عنوان منبع تبلیغ اضافه کنید


در زیر کارت Waterfall در بخش Ad Sources ، Add Source Ad را انتخاب کنید. سپس i-mobile را انتخاب کنید.

i-mobile را انتخاب کرده و کلید Optimize را فعال کنید. برای تنظیم بهینه‌سازی منبع آگهی برای i-mobile، نام ورود و گذرواژه API را که در بخش قبل به دست آورده‌اید، وارد کنید. سپس یک مقدار eCPM برای i-mobile وارد کنید و روی Continue کلیک کنید.



اگر قبلاً نقشه ای برای i-mobile دارید، می توانید آن را انتخاب کنید. در غیر این صورت، روی افزودن نقشه کلیک کنید.

در مرحله بعد، شناسه ناشر ، شناسه رسانه و شناسه Spot را که در بخش قبل به دست آمده است وارد کنید. سپس روی Done کلیک کنید.

مرحله 3: SDK و آداپتور i-mobile را وارد کنید

در فایل settings.gradle.kts سطح پروژه خود، مخازن زیر را اضافه کنید:

dependencyResolutionManagement {
  repositories {
    google()
    mavenCentral()
    maven {
      url = uri("https://imobile.github.io/adnw-sdk-android")
    }
  }
}

سپس، در فایل build.gradle.kts در سطح برنامه خود، وابستگی ها و پیکربندی های پیاده سازی زیر را اضافه کنید. از آخرین نسخه‌های i-mobile SDK و آداپتور استفاده کنید:

dependencies {
    implementation("com.google.android.gms:play-services-ads:23.5.0")
    implementation("com.google.ads.mediation:imobile:2.3.2.0")
}

ادغام دستی

  1. آخرین نسخه i-mobile SDK را دانلود کنید و android-ad-sdk.aar را در زیر پوشه sdk استخراج کرده و به پروژه خود اضافه کنید.

  2. به مصنوعات آداپتور i-mobile در مخزن Maven Google بروید. آخرین نسخه را انتخاب کنید، فایل .aar آداپتور i-mobile را دانلود کرده و آن را به پروژه خود اضافه کنید.

مرحله 4: کد مورد نیاز را اضافه کنید

هیچ کد اضافی برای ادغام i-mobile مورد نیاز نیست.

مرحله 5: اجرای خود را آزمایش کنید

فعال کردن تبلیغات آزمایشی

مطمئن شوید که دستگاه آزمایشی خود را برای AdMob ثبت کرده اید. i-mobile برای تست Spot ID ، Media ID و Publisher ID ارائه می‌کند، می‌توانید آنها را در اینجا پیدا کنید.

تبلیغات آزمایشی را تأیید کنید

برای تأیید اینکه آگهی‌های آزمایشی را از i-mobile دریافت می‌کنید، با استفاده از منبع(های) آگهی i-mobile (Waterfall) آزمایش منبع آگهی را در ad inspector فعال کنید.

مراحل اختیاری

استفاده از تبلیغات بومی

رندر آگهی

آداپتور i-mobile موارد زیر را پر می کندتوضیحات فیلد پیشرفته تبلیغات بومیبرای یکNativeAd .

میدان دارایی ها همیشه توسط آداپتور i-mobile گنجانده شده است
تیتر
تصویر
بدن
نماد برنامه 1
فراخوان به اقدام
امتیاز ستاره
فروشگاه
قیمت

1 برای تبلیغات بومی، i-mobile SDK دارایی نماد برنامه را ارائه نمی دهد. در عوض، آداپتور i-mobile نماد برنامه را با یک تصویر شفاف پر می کند.

کدهای خطا

اگر آداپتور نتواند تبلیغی را از i-mobile دریافت کند، ناشران می توانند با استفاده از پاسخ آگهی، خطای اساسی را بررسی کنند.ResponseInfo.getAdapterResponses()تحت کلاس های زیر:

قالب نام کلاس
بنر com.google.ads.mediation.imobile.IMobileAdapter
بینابینی com.google.ads.mediation.imobile.IMobileAdapter
بومی com.google.ads.mediation.imobile.IMobileMediationAdapter

در اینجا کدها و پیام‌های همراهی که توسط آداپتور i-mobile پرتاب می‌شود، در صورت عدم بارگیری آگهی آمده است:

کد خطا دلیل
0-99 i-mobile SDK یک خطا را نشان داد. برای جزئیات بیشتر به کد مراجعه کنید.
101 i-mobile برای بارگیری تبلیغات به یک زمینه Activity نیاز دارد.
102 پارامترهای سرور i-mobile پیکربندی شده در AdMob رابط کاربری موجود نیست/نامعتبر است.
103 اندازه آگهی درخواستی با اندازه بنر پشتیبانی شده از i-mobile مطابقت ندارد.
104 پاسخ به تماس موفقیت آمیز بارگیری آگهی بومی i-mobile یک لیست تبلیغات بومی خالی را برگرداند.

I-mobile Android Mediation Adapter Changelog

نسخه 2.3.2.0

  • سازگاری تایید شده با i-mobile SDK v2.3.2.

ساخته و تست شده با:

  • Google Mobile Ads SDK نسخه 23.1.0.
  • IMobile SDK نسخه 2.3.2.

نسخه 2.3.1.2

  • حداقل نسخه مورد نیاز Google Mobile Ads SDK به 23.0.0 به روز شد.
  • سازگاری تایید شده با i-mobile SDK v2.3.1.

ساخته و تست شده با:

  • Google Mobile Ads SDK نسخه 23.0.0.
  • IMobile SDK نسخه 2.3.1.

نسخه 2.3.1.1

  • آداپتور به‌روزرسانی شده برای استفاده از کلاس جدید VersionInfo .
  • حداقل نسخه مورد نیاز Google Mobile Ads SDK به 22.0.0 به روز شد.

ساخته و تست شده با:

  • Google Mobile Ads SDK نسخه 22.0.0.
  • IMobile SDK نسخه 2.3.1.

نسخه 2.3.1.0

  • سازگاری تایید شده با i-mobile SDK v2.3.1.
  • حداقل نسخه مورد نیاز Google Mobile Ads SDK به 21.5.0 به روز شد.

ساخته و تست شده با:

  • Google Mobile Ads SDK نسخه 21.5.0.
  • IMobile SDK نسخه 2.3.1.

نسخه 2.3.0.0

  • سازگاری تایید شده با i-mobile SDK v2.3.0.
  • حداقل نسخه مورد نیاز Google Mobile Ads SDK به 21.3.0 به روز شد.

ساخته و تست شده با:

  • Google Mobile Ads SDK نسخه 21.3.0.
  • IMobile SDK نسخه 2.3.0.

نسخه 2.0.23.1

  • compileSdkVersion و targetSdkVersion را به API 31 به روز کرد.
  • حداقل نسخه مورد نیاز Google Mobile Ads SDK را به 21.0.0 به روز کرد.
  • حداقل سطح API Android مورد نیاز را به 19 به روز کرد.

ساخته و تست شده با:

  • Google Mobile Ads SDK نسخه 21.0.0.
  • IMobile SDK نسخه 2.0.23.

نسخه 2.0.23.0

  • سازگاری تایید شده با i-mobile SDK v2.0.23.
  • حداقل نسخه مورد نیاز Google Mobile Ads SDK به 20.5.0 به روز شد.

ساخته و تست شده با

  • Google Mobile Ads SDK نسخه 20.5.0.
  • IMobile SDK نسخه 2.0.23.

نسخه 2.0.22.2

  • کدها و پیام های خطای استاندارد آداپتور اضافه شده است.
  • حداقل نسخه مورد نیاز Google Mobile Ads SDK به 20.1.0 به روز شد.

ساخته و تست شده با

  • Google Mobile Ads SDK نسخه 20.1.0.
  • IMobile SDK نسخه 2.0.22.

نسخه 2.0.22.1

  • حداقل نسخه مورد نیاز Google Mobile Ads SDK را به 20.0.0 به روز کرد.

ساخته و تست شده با

  • Google Mobile Ads SDK نسخه 20.0.0.
  • IMobile SDK نسخه 2.0.22.

نسخه 2.0.22.0

  • سازگاری تایید شده با i-mobile SDK v2.0.22.
  • آداپتور را برای پشتیبانی از درخواست های بنر تطبیقی ​​درون خطی به روز کرد.

ساخته و تست شده با

  • Google Mobile Ads SDK نسخه 19.1.0.
  • IMobile SDK نسخه 2.0.22.

نسخه 2.0.21.0

  • سازگاری تایید شده با i-mobile SDK v2.0.21.
  • حداقل نسخه مورد نیاز Google Mobile Ads SDK به 19.1.0 به روز شد.
  • پشتیبانی از مقیاس بندی تبلیغات بنری تطبیقی ​​اضافه شده است.

ساخته و تست شده با

  • Google Mobile Ads SDK نسخه 19.1.0.
  • IMobile SDK نسخه 2.0.21.

نسخه 2.0.20.2

  • پشتیبانی از اندازه های تبلیغاتی بنر انعطاف پذیر اضافه شده است.
  • حداقل نسخه مورد نیاز Google Mobile Ads SDK به 18.3.0 به روز شد.

ساخته و تست شده با

  • Google Mobile Ads SDK نسخه 18.3.0.
  • IMobile SDK نسخه 2.0.20.

نسخه 2.0.20.1

  • آداپتور اکنون نسبت ابعادی mediaContent غیر صفر را برمی‌گرداند.

ساخته و تست شده با

  • Google Mobile Ads SDK نسخه 18.2.0.
  • IMobile SDK نسخه 2.0.20.

نسخه 2.0.20.0

  • انتشار اولیه!
  • پشتیبانی از تبلیغات بنر، بینابینی و بومی اضافه شده است.